I'd very much like to know everyone's views about something that has
just happened to me; here's the story:
I gave a nice print--as a gift--to a friend. My friend's father-in-law
took the print to get it framed, and come to find out, he also made some
scans of the print and gave them to family members. I'm just going to
come out and say it--I'm really irked by this. I often sign my prints
in the lower right hand edge, but I didn't on this print.
How irked would you guys be? What, if anything, would you guys do or say?
It's not worth the candle to get all het up about it. The person
concerned (and this seems to be most folks, these days) does not even
remotely understand what your concerns could be. If copying work was not
meant to be, than all the copying devices that pervade our society would
not be allowed to exist, would they? I have far too little life left to
be bothered by these sorts of actions. If it's something that I
_really_ want to keep to myself, others don't get to see it. If it gets
out of my hands, the reality is that it's public domain.
